Rodgers, MJ, Banks, DJ, Bradley, KA and Young, JA (2014) CHD1 and CHD2 are positive regulators of HIV-1 gene expression. Virol. J. 11:180

Abstract

Retroviruses encode a very limited number of proteins and therefore must exploit a wide variety of host proteins for completion of their lifecycle.

Figure 4 panel C shows a decrease in HIV-1 transcripts in cells that underwent siRNA-mediated knockdown of CHD1 compared to the control. Figure 4 panel C shows an increase in transcripts in cells transfected with plasmids encoding tagged CHD1.
